H3C S9825 and S9855 switch series are a new generation of high-performance and high-density 400GE, 200GE, and 100GE switches launched by H3C for data centers and high-end campuses. The S9825 and S9855 switches provide high-density 400GE, 200GE, 100GE, 25GE, and 10GE ports and support power supply and fan module redundancy. You can deploy them in the new generation of data center core and aggregation networks. By connecting to upstream S12500 core switches through 400GE or 200GE links and to downstream access switches through 200GE, 100GE, or 40GE links, the S9825 and S9855 switches provide high bandwidth and large-capacity server access.

The S9855-48CD8D, S9855-24B8D, S9855-40B, or S9855-32D switch can operate correctly with only one power supply. You can install two power supplies for 1+1 redundancy.
The S9825-64D switch can operate correctly with two power supplies. You can install three power supplies for 2+1 redundancy or four power supplies for 2+2 redundancy.
To ensure heat dissipation, make sure all fan module slots on the S9855-48CD8D, S9855-24B8D, S9855-40B, and S9855-32D switches have fan modules installed and the fan modules are the same model.
The S9825-64D switch with the LS-S9825-64D product code has six fan module slots. To ensure heat dissipation, make sure all fan module slots on the switch have fan modules installed and the fan modules are the same model.
The S9825-64D switch with the LS-9825-64D-H1 product code has eight fan module slots. When you install ZR or ZR+ modules in the two lower rows of ports on the switch, make sure all fan module slots on the switch have fan modules installed. In other situations, you can install six fan modules in slots FAN3 to FAN8.

4 Ports and LEDs
As a best practice, use H3C transceiver modules and cables for the switch. H3C transceiver modules and cables are subject to change over time. For the most up-to-date list of H3C transceiver modules and cables, contact H3C Support or marketing staff.
For information about the specifications of H3C transceiver modules and cables, see H3C Transceiver Modules User Guide.
Ports
Console port
The switch has a serial console port.
Table4-1 Console port specifications
|
Item |
Serial console port |
|
Connector type |
RJ-45 |
|
Compliant standard |
EIA/TIA-232 |
|
Transmission baud rate |
9600 bps (default) to 115200 bps |
|
Services |
· Provides connection to an ASCII terminal. · Provides connection to the serial port of a local terminal (a PC for example) running a terminal emulation program. |
Management Ethernet port
The switch has a copper management Ethernet port. You can connect the port to a local PC for software loading and debugging or to a remote management station for remote management.
Table4-2 Management Ethernet port specifications
|
Item |
Specification |
|
Connector type |
RJ-45 |
|
Port quantity |
1 × management 10/100/1000BASE-T port |
|
Port transmission rate, duplex mode, and auto MDI/MDI-X |
· 10/100 Mbps, half/full duplex, auto MDI/MDI-X · 1000 Mbps, full duplex, auto MDI/MDI-X |
|
Transmission medium and max transmission distance |
100 m (328.08 ft) over category 5 UTP cable |
|
Functions and services |
Software upgrade and network management. |
USB port
The switch has one OHCI-compliant USB 2.0 port that can upload and download data at a rate up to 480 Mbps. You can use this USB port to access the file system on the flash of the switch, for example, to upload or download application and configuration files.
The USB port supplies power as per USB 2.0 specifications. Use only USB 2.0-compliant USB devices for the USB port. The port might not identify USB devices that are not compliant with USB 2.0.

QSFP-DD port
The S9825-64D switch with the LS-9825-64D or LS-9825-64D-H1 product code provides 64 QSFP-DD ports. You can install ZR modules in the first row of ports on the switch. For the S9825-64D switch with the LS-9825-64D-H1 product code, you can also install ZR modules in the two lower rows of ports and ZR+ modules in the lowest row of ports. The 48 ports that support ZR modules on the switch are in pink.
The S9855-48CD8D and S9825-24B8D switches each provide eight QSFP-DD ports on the front panel.
The S9855-32D switch provides 32 QSFP-DD ports on the front panel.
QSFP-DD ports support the following transceiver modules and cables:
· QSFP28 transceiver modules.
· QSFP28 cables.
· QSFP56 transceiver modules.
· QSFP56 cables.
· QSFP-DD transceiver modules.
· QSFP-DD cables.
The eight QSFP-DD ports on the S9825-24B8D switch also support the following transceiver modules and cables:
· QSFP+ transceiver modules.
· QSFP+ cables.
· QSFP28 to 4 × 25G SFP28 cables.
The QSFP-DD ports on the S9855-32D switch also support QSFP+ modules and QSFP+ cables.
The QSFP-DD ports on the S9825-64D switch also support QSFP-DD to 2 × 200G QSFP56 cables. Such cables are not provided. Purchase them yourself as required.
QSFP56 port
The S9825-24B8D switch provides 24 QSFP56 ports.
The S9855-40B switch provides 40 QSFP56 ports.
QSFP56 ports support the following transceiver modules and cables:
· QSFP+ transceiver modules.
· QSFP+ cables.
· QSFP+ to 4 × 10G SFP+ cables.
· QSFP28 transceiver modules.
· QSFP28 cables.
· QSFP28 to 4 × 25G SFP28 cables.
· QSFP56 transceiver modules.
· QSFP56 cables
· QSFP56 to 2 × 100G QSFP28 cables.

QSFP56 port LED
Each QSFP56 port has two status LEDs to indicate port operating status and activities. Table4-5 provides the LED description for a QSFP56 port that is not split. Table4-6 provides the LED description for a QSFP56 port split into two breakout interfaces.
Table4-5 LED description for a QSFP56 port that is not split
|
LED status |
Description |
|
Steady green |
A transceiver module or cable has been correctly installed in the port. The port is operating at its maximum speed of 200 Gbps, and a link is present on the port. |
|
Flashing green |
The port is sending or receiving data at its maximum speed of 200 Gbps. |
|
Steady yellow |
A transceiver module or cable has been correctly installed in the port. The port is operating at a speed lower than the maximum speed, and a link is present on the port. |
|
Flashing yellow |
The port is sending or receiving data at a speed lower than the maximum speed. |
|
Off |
No transceiver module or cable has been installed in the port, or no link is present on the port. |
Table4-6 LED description for a QSFP56 port split into two breakout interfaces
|
LED status |
Description |
|
Steady green |
A transceiver module or cable has been correctly installed in the port. The port is operating at its maximum speed of 100 Gbps, and a link is present on the port. |
|
Flashing green |
The port is sending or receiving data at its maximum speed of 100 Gbps. |
|
Off |
No transceiver module or cable has been installed in the port, or no link is present on the port. |
|
|
NOTE: When the port is split into two breakout interfaces, QSFP56 port LED 1 indicates the operating status of the first breakout interface and QSFP56 port LED 2 indicates the operating status of the second breakout interface. For the LED description, see Table4-6. |

Table4-13 Description for the LED on a PSR1300-12A-C-B or PSR1300-12A-C-A power supply
|
LED status |
Description |
|
Steady green |
The power supply is operating correctly. |
|
Flashing green at 1 Hz |
The power supply is in standby state. |
|
Flashing green at 2 Hz |
The power supply is updating software. |
|
Flashing green at 0.33 Hz |
The power supply enters cold redundancy state. |
|
Steady amber |
The power supply does not have AC input, but the redundant power supply connected in parallel has normal power input. |
|
Flashing amber |
The power supply is operating correctly, but an overtemperature, overpower, overcurrent, or slow fan speed alarm has occurred. |
|
Off |
The power supply is not securely installed or has no power input. |
